How to add arrow icons to expand and collapse any row in Angular Mat-Table with Expandable Rows? Free Expand collapse arrows icons in custom colors, PNG, SVG, GIF for web, mobile. As the length of the text labels might impact where users look or click, we ensured that label lengths in each prototype were distributed equally and that the correct answer for each task (i.e. To analyze the responses to the post-task question (regarding expectations to stay on the page) we defined the new-page expectation as a binary variable quantifying whether participants expected to stay on the same page (0) or go to a new page (1). FREE. Download Expand collapse arrows blue icons for free in various UI design styles This is what it looks like in ui5-customization-m.Panel.css: Note the span[data-sap-ui-icon-content=].sapUiIcon::before is the essential bit that allows us to react to a specific icon value. The reason is that in this case the icon is driven directly by an attribute value, not by change of style class. with this approach you can easily toggle arrow icon by: $ ('div.arrow').toggleClass ('expanded'); Or you can check expand/collapse by: var isExpanded = $ ('div.arrow').is ('.expanded'); Share Follow edited Sep 16, 2013 at 7:38 answered Sep 16, 2013 at 7:28 frogatto 28.1k 10 81 128 2 March 3, 2023. So then I went on a search to try and discover why the arrow could not be showing on the page you linked to. We performed a quantitative study to find out which of these icons is the most effective at signaling that it will open an accordion. For all other icons (arrow, foil, plus), there was no statistically significant preference for the icon. (You can read more about the sap-icon uri protocol in the Icon topic of the SAP UI5 walkthrough). My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? We also created 5 different variations for each prototype; each variation used one of 4 possible icons (an arrow, a caret, a plus, a foil) or no icon. It depends on the interface, Gennerally I call them call links or select boxes. I'm going to have a button in the header of an expanding panel. Get free Expand collapse arrows icons in iOS, Material, Windows and other design styles for web, mobile, and graphic design projects. In this case, there are no separate classes corresponding to the collapsed/expanded state of the Panel. Subscribe to the weekly newsletter to get notified about future articles. ), (You may recall that \e1e2 is the character that corresponds to the navigation-down-arrow icon.). Are there tables of wastage rates for different fruit and veg? Why are non-Western countries siding with China in the UN? While an obvious finding, this is more evidence that users tend to interact with strong, clear signifiers. Doubling the cube, field extensions and minimal polynoms. For example, there is no property that allows you to change the icon that a sap.m.Panel uses for its exapand/collapse button thats just part of how the Panel happens to be coded its part of its structure.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. These royalty-free high-quality Collapse Arrow Vector Icons are available in SVG, PNG, EPS, ICO, ICNS, AI, or PDF and are available as individual or icon packs.. You can also customise them to match your brand and color palette! How to tell which packages are held back due to phased updates, Using indicator constraint with two variables. The selector part before is there to ensure the rule will only apply to the expand/collapse button of a Panel, and not to some random other controls icon. He combines his expertise in website usability with experience managing a team of designers and developers to successfully implement UX best practices across a range of platforms. Where does this (supposedly) Gibson quote come from? Tip:If youre working on a touch device, tap to place your cursor in the heading to see the triangle. Connect and share knowledge within a single location that is structured and easy to search. Available in PNG and SVG formats. What characters can be used for up/down triangle (arrow without stem) for display in HTML? javascript - How to add arrow icons to expand and collapse any row in rev2023.3.3.43278. We placed the accordion icon to the right of its associated label, close to the edge of the screen and right aligned. Bulk update symbol size units from mm to map units in rule-based symbology. August 23, 2020. Instead, the content property of the .sapUiIcon::before pseudo-class uses the value of the elements data-sap-ui-icon-content attribute. As you can see the arrow with the menu1 is not down. I've just tried out an accordion block on 5.7 myself, and had no problems with it. We only have to write our own rules for the sapUiTableTreeIconNodeOpen::before and sapUiTableTreeIconNodeClosed::before classes to mask the default ones, and assign the proper value for the content property: (You will find similar rules in the ui5-customization-ui.tree.TreeTable.css provided by this ui5tip). WPF - TreeView hide expand icon (arrow) Ask Question Asked 10 years ago Modified 10 years ago Viewed 12k times 11 Is there a way how can I hide expand/collapse icon for all treeview? @Stphane The last you mentioned is my new favorite :). Choose the account you want to sign in with. You can then navigate to index.html to see the sample app in effect. Accordion Icons: Which Signifiers Work Best? - Nielsen Norman Group Expand button. Previous page Next page. We prepared a separate CSS file for each of the aforementioned UI5 controls, and included them into the app via the manifest.json: Before we discuss how to apply the CSS to change the icons, its useful to understand how UI5 icon rendering works. The expand / collapse arrows show up as expected on Chrome desktop, and other browsers I tested too.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? @GerardWesterhof, oh you're right, but it's better to use image for this work because special characters may not appear correctly in some browsers, but still possible with my approach, see update, Auto toggle expand/collapse arrow on load, How Intuit democratizes AI development across teams through reusability. Because of this, I want the row to expand/collapse only when the arrow icon (on the right) is clicked. rev2023.3.3.43278. The arrow is not statistically different than the foil or no-icon conditions, suggesting that this icon should not be used for accordions. of 10 . For the standard signifiers (caret, plus, and arrow), there was no strong expectation to leave the page (as the rate of new-page expectation is not significantly different than 50%, p >0.05). To collapse or expand all the headings in your document, right-click the heading and click Expand/Collapse > Expand All Headings or Collapse All Headings. Download icons in all formats or edit them for your designs. First, lets take a look at the standard UI5 controls. Besuchsdienst - Freiwilligenarbeit Stiftung Diakoniewerk Neumnster Or, if you think you might be overloading your readers with too much information, you can display summaries and leave it to your readers to open the summary and read the details if they want. .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Want more tips? This way, the sap.ui.TreeTable only needs to change the style class from sapUiTableTreeIconNodeClosed to sapUiTableTreeIconNodeOpen on the , depending on the expanded/collapsted state of the row: the css magic will take care of rendering the right icon. User Profile, My Account, or just Settings? . In UI design, sometimes settings are hidden behind a little arrow or "+" symbol. How to declutter my row item / make it more functionally appealing? Arrow Zoom Fullscreen Minimize Scale Arrows Dropdown List.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. Jquery's UI library has defined line of code for every particular icon. Replacing broken pins/legs on a DIP IC package. Create designs using a drag-n-drop library of high-quality graphics, Illustrations from top Dribbble illustrators, 100+ moving pictures to liven up your designs, Drag and drop illustrations to other apps, Protect your identity with generative media, Generate unique, expressive AI-generated faces in real time. Also, be sure to check out new icons and popular icons. On the Home tab, click the arrow in the Paragraph group. For example: "Click on the little arrow and edit the details for", Versus: "Click on the and editetc". Find centralized, trusted content and collaborate around the technologies you use most. This makes it really quite simple to change the icons. We also looked at whether people tend to tap the label or the icon for these different signifiers, under the assumption that, if indeed there is a strong tendency to tap only on one of them, we could, perhaps, separate the functionality of the two (a la split buttons). Taps outside the area associated with the accordion were relatively few (58%), and most taps fell either on the label or on the icon associated with the accordions (and not on the space in between the two). In this tip, you'll learn how you can replace them with more appropriate icons using only a few lines of CSS. Asking for help, clarification, or responding to other answers. (The .notdef glyph is the boxed question mark). line, glyph, dualtone, flat, colored outline, gradient.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. The prototypes were not interactive; they were simple mockups with the menu already open and a list of categories visible on the screen, to ensure that we were only measuring the interaction with the accordions, as opposed to users efforts to locate the menus, look at homepage content, and so forth. Learn more about Stack Overflow the company, and our products.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? c# - WPF - TreeView hide expand icon (arrow) - Stack Overflow Content. The only thing we really need to think of when applying this stylesheet is that it is loaded after UI5 framework loads the CSS specific to the ui.tree.TreeTable control: if our CSS is loaded before the frameworks CSS, then our rules will be masked by the frameworks, and we want to do it exactly the other way around. When you close and reopen a document, the headings will be expanded by default. The details of how a particular control renderer renders its structural icons can still vary a bit, and well need to figure out how a particular control renders its icons before we can change them. the menu option that was likely to be chosen by users) was of a different length in each prototype. These royalty-free high-quality Expand Collapse Vector Icons are available in SVG, PNG, EPS, ICO, ICNS, AI, or PDF and are available . By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. 1.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. icon for disconnect button . 504 Collapse Arrow Icons - Free in SVG, PNG, ICO - IconScout Expand and collapse icons for mat table with accordion - Angular Connect and share knowledge within a single location that is structured and easy to search. Font Awesome is the internet's icon library and toolkit used by millions of designers, developers, and content creators. Stackblitz :https://stackblitz.com/edit/angular-yr45pl. Not the answer you're looking for? Get free Expand collapse arrows icons in iOS, Material, Windows and other design styles for web, mobile, and graphic design projects. But this would involve rewriting or overriding the sap.m.Panel or its renderer, and were not quite prepared to do that just to change the icon. In other words, whats the best signifier for accordions? Expand arrow Icons - Download for Free in PNG and SVG An ANOVA on the data for when users tapped on the text label found a significant effect of icon type both when participants or prototypes were treated as the random factor. Download icons in all formats or edit them for your designs. For the arrow indicators I would use the name of the symbol yet again, as in "click the arrow to expand the content and/or show the details.". But all the icons in all rows are changed. ( A girl said this after she killed a demon and saved MC). Collapse - Ant Design document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); This site uses Akismet to reduce spam. Download 20864 free Expand collapse arrows Icons in All design styles. The best answers are voted up and rise to the top, Not the answer you're looking for? You can copy the text from the data-sap-ui-icon-content attribute in the browser tools and paste it in a hex editor, or in a javascript string to figure out what its character code is, for example: It turns out that this corresponds to UI5s slim-arrow-down icon, which has a similar appearance to the down-arrow icon.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Communities help you ask and answer questions, give feedback, and hear from experts with rich knowledge. Bootstrap 4 Collapse show state with Font Awesome icon How do you get out of a corner when plotting yourself into a corner. Icons; Illustrations; 3D illustrations; Designers; Free icons; Pricing. Users tend to click fairly equally on both the accordion icon and the accordion label, so avoid dissociating those by assigning them different functionalities. It can be used to collapse any contents like FAQs, explanation of a term, or as a general-purpose accordion. If you want the document to open with the . - JohnDubya Oct 27, 2016 at 21:06 Add a comment 3 So is there a consensus? Also, when the page is loaded, one of the menu will expand automatically according to the page. Summary:The caret icon most clearly indicated to users that it would open an accordion in place, rather than linking directly to a new page. How to Create Bootstrap Collapsible Panel with Up/Down Arrow Icon 1. Pairwise contrasts indicated that the no-icon condition was significantly different than all other conditions. I think you are talking about the carats. It will render whatever text is in the elements data-sap-ui-icon-content attribute. For an accordion, where we want to convey that the page wont change, the rate should ideally be under 50%. If this is still a question/issue nowadays, post the part of the code that does the menu sliding on document ready. I tend to use Show/Hide, although I'm sure other terms are fine :). And, heres what it looks like in the sample app: The sap.m.Tree uses exactly the same mechanism to render the icons as the sap.m.Panel does the character that corresponds to the appropriate icon glyph is written to a data-sap-ui-icon-content, and the value of the attribute is rendered against the icon fonts font face. I somehow achieved the functionality which is working fine. That being said: Using a caret is definitely better than using no icon at all or a random icon in terms of conveying the expectation to stay on the page (and open an accordion). Authors; Icons; Stickers; Interface icons; Animated icons . The sap.ui.table.TreeTable renderer takes a straightforward approach to rendering the collapse/expand icons. Asking for help, clarification, or responding to other answers. What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? Collapse or expand parts of a document - Microsoft Support Expand collapse arrows Blue Icons - Free Download SVG, PNG, GIF Download 34426 free Expand arrow Icons in All design styles. Angular material expand one row at a time and close all other opened row, Alternate color with Angular Material mat-table with parent child rows. As we have just witnessed, the sap.ui.table.TreeTable uses separate classes for the collapse and expand icons. Specific name for a collapsible bottom drawer menu? 4. Before publishing, we test and review each code snippet to avoid errors, but we cannot warrant the full correctness of all content. Materials. 504 Collapse Arrow Icons. User Experience Stack Exchange is a question and answer site for user experience researchers and experts. Tell us about an icon you need, and we will draw it for free in one of the existing Icons8 styles. For each prototype, we created a task that involved finding information in one of the accordions visible in the prototype. Is it possible to create a concave light? 2. You can hide the arrow icon by passing showArrow={false} to CollapsePanel component. Get free Expand collapse + icons in iOS, Material, Windows and other design styles for web, mobile, and graphic design projects. How to redirect one HTML page to another on load, how to show contents of Div based on options in a list angular 2/4. Then, press Ctrl+S to save your document to its original location.
Joe Pesci Daughter Special Needs, Sally Rand Cause Of Death, Churchill County Arrests, Articles E